Estelle “Shine”

I stumbled upon Estelle’s album “Shine” innocently at my local Rasputin Music in Vallejo, CA. With a hot like “Amreican Boy” featuring KanYe West, I swear to you I never once saw a video on MTV (maybe it was on at 3am?!) or the single played on any commercial radio. Instead, the promo copy was played from start to finish as I was shopping in the store. Estelle’s new album “Shine” has to be a sleeper hit spread out through word of mouth and the internet.
Already considered a solid UK act Estelle is all vocals with no baggage. (drama, lol) Already having an established friendship to John Legend (and signed to his label Home School Records / Atlantic) “Shine” features collaborations with the Kanye West, Will.I.Am, Wyclef Jean, Mark Ronson, Ceelo, Swizz Beatz and Kardinal Official. Think of it as a splash of funk, jazz, soul and hip hop with that british flare with her soft vocals. Overall, the production is over the top and simply melodic with Estelle ranging in comparisons to Amy Winehouse, Lily Allen and even Lauren Hill with her soft spoken melodies.
